Job Summary

Manages the day-to-day operations of a single site or multiple sites, and establishes and maintains performance and productivity metrics and cost management processes.

Essential Duties And Responsibilities

  • Manages the day-to-day operations of the District, and provides daily support to managers in ensuring quality and budget performance.
  • Maintains budget and operating metrics while diagnosing and improving processes, procedures, and performance.
  • Executes the Market's strategic capital budget, ensuring effective use of the budget through asset allocation; ensures appropriate spare ratios and asset disposal.
  • Ensures thorough root cause investigations for all injuries and incidents, following-up with consistent discipline and retraining.
  • Oversees personnel needs of the department including selecting, coaching, disciplining, and training employees and evaluating employee performance. Provides input into termination, compensation, and promotion decisions.
  • Formulates both short-term and long-term goals and action plans in conjunction with the Market Area General Manager and/or Director of Operations.
  • Participates in regular P&L reviews to ensure that budgets are met; develops and implements programs for optimal equipment utilization, equipment maintenance, and labor and material costs.
  • Interacts with local city, municipal, and county agencies to ensure customer satisfaction, improve efficiency, renew contracts and negotiate new contracts; establishes WM as a good corporate citizen and valued resource.
  • Engages suppliers in problem solving and participates in suppliers' improvement processes by providing performance feedback on supplier surveys.
  • Works with functional groups to resolve employee relations and labor relations issues.
